Well Go USA has announced that they will be releasing the South Korean zombie thriller Train to Busan Presents: Peninsula from director Yeon Sang-ho on Digital October 27, and 4K UHD Combo Pack, Blu-Ray Combo Pack and DVD on November 24, 2020. The film is the follow-up to the nail-biting international hit Train to Busan. Bonus content includes a making-of featurette, interviews with cast & crew and an all-new English dub.

Synopsis: Four years after South Korea’s total decimation in TRAIN TO BUSAN, the zombie thriller that captivated audiences worldwide, acclaimed director Yeon Sang-ho brings us PENINSULA, the next nail-biting chapter in his post-apocalyptic world. Jung-seok, a soldier who previously escaped the diseased wasteland, relives the horror when assigned to a covert operation with two simple objectives: retrieve and survive. When his team unexpectedly stumbles upon survivors, their lives will depend on whether the best—or worst—of human nature prevails in the direst of circumstance.
